  8. Add Roman Bath House and Wery Wall Remains to your Itinerary

    Roman Bath House and Wery Wall Remains

    Type

    Type:

    Historic Site

    Lancaster

    The Wery Wall is an interesting surviving fragment of Roman walling on the east slope of Castle Hill and represents a section of a bastion of the last Roman fort on the site. Adjacent to the wall are the excavated remains of a small Roman bathhouse.

  14. Add Lancaster Canal to your Itinerary

    Lancaster Canal

    Type

    Type:

    Canal / Waterway / Marina

    Waterside Drive , Wigan,

    Built to carry trade between Kendal and Preston, Lancaster Canal is now a haven for wildlife. The towpath stretches over 27 miles and is ideal for peaceful countryside walks.

    Lancaster Maritime Museum

    Type

    Type:

    Museum

    Lancaster

    Lancaster Maritime Museum is housed in the Port of Lancaster Custom House and warehouse buildings dating from the second half of the 18th Century. Discover the history of the merchants and learn about Lancaster’s exciting trade industry.
